Hi All Here is a call for the people in the voting committee [1] on the decision of extending it. Using the same guidelines as in the second extension [2], the following candidates were found: git log libav/master..master --no-merges --since=2018-03-30T00:00:00Z --until 2019-03-30T00:00:00Z --pretty=fuller | grep '^Commit:' | sed 's/<.*//' |sort | uniq -c | sort -nr 662 Commit: Michael Niedermayer 528 Commit: Paul B Mahol 227 Commit: James Almer 194 Commit: Carl Eugen Hoyos 183 Commit: Mark Thompson 141 Commit: Marton Balint 99 Commit: Jun Zhao 84 Commit: Steven Liu 73 Commit: Martin Vignali 64 Commit: Gyan Doshi 55 Commit: Aman Gupta 42 Commit: Timo Rothenpieler 35 Commit: Zhong Li 31 Commit: Karthick Jeyapal 31 Commit: Karthick J 23 Commit: Rostislav Pehlivanov 22 Commit: Peter Ross 22 Commit: Clément Bœsch 21 Commit: Lou Logan 21 Commit: Jan Ekström Some of these developers are already in the voting committee, the new ones would be: Aman Gupta Gyan Doshi Jan Ekström Jun Zhao Karthick Jeyapal Mark Thompson Martin Vignali Peter Ross Steven Liu Timo Rothenpieler Zhong Li Question: Do you support extending the voting committte with the people above? I suggest a deadline for making a decision on these 11 people of 7 days starting now. Hi Michael, The patch you committed seems to break the cropping to even width / height as required by SDL overlay code. Also there can be a use case for inserting the auto rotation filter after the user provided filter chain as well. (e,g, deinterlacing). I don't think we can make everyone happy, so unless you have a better idea, I think it would be best if you could just revert the patch.
